Skip to main content
HolixoraHOLIXORA
← Back to portfolio

Fintech / DeFi

OnPay

Decentralized payment gateway on Solana with any-to-stable swap.

MVP2025
OnPay preview

Overview

OnPay is a decentralized payment gateway built on the Solana blockchain that enables merchants to accept any SPL token while always receiving USDC. The system performs real-time any-to-stable swaps so buyers can pay with whatever token they hold, and merchants receive stable value without exposure to crypto volatility.

The architecture is fully non-custodial — funds flow directly from buyer through the swap to the seller's wallet, with no intermediary holding funds at any point. Smart routing through the Jupiter aggregator ensures the best swap rates across Solana's liquidity pools.

With QR code payments for in-person transactions and transaction fees below 0.5%, OnPay makes crypto payments practical for everyday businesses.

Status

MVP

Year

2025

Category

Fintech / DeFi

Tech Stack

SolanaRustReactJupiter AggregatorSPL TokenAnchor Framework

The Challenge

Merchants want to accept crypto payments but face two major barriers: price volatility (receiving a token that could lose 20% overnight) and fragmentation (needing to support dozens of different tokens). Existing solutions are either custodial, expensive, or too complex for small businesses.

The Solution

We built a non-custodial payment gateway on Solana with automatic any-to-stable swap via Jupiter aggregator. Buyers pay with any SPL token, merchants always receive USDC. Smart routing finds optimal swap paths, QR codes enable in-person payments, and Rust smart contracts ensure security and speed at under 0.5% fees.

Key Features

What we built

Any-to-stable swap (any SPL token to USDC)

Non-custodial fund flow

Smart routing via Jupiter aggregator

QR code payment generation

Merchant dashboard

Transaction history and reporting

Sub-second settlement on Solana

Results

The results

Non-custodial architecture: no intermediary holds funds

Any-to-stable swap: buyers pay with any SPL token, merchants get USDC

Transaction fees below 0.5%

QR code payments for in-person transactions

Built and presented at Solana Frontier Hackathon

Technology

Built with

SolanaRustReactJupiter AggregatorSPL TokenAnchor Framework

Interested in a similar solution?

Let's discuss how we can build something tailored to your specific needs.